Just one day out from the start of the ISAF Sailing World Cup Qingdao and Great Britain’s Hannah Snellgrove is looking forward to her first time sailing in the Qingdao waters.
Nicknamed Fruitcake(according to her ISAF Sailor ID), Snellgrove has previously been to China to sail in the Laser Radial Worlds in Rizhao, but this will be her first World Cup event at the venue of the Beijing 2008 sailing competition.
Having been out on the water for the past two days and keeping an eye on the forecast, Snellgrove has been keeping in mind what she would like, but also what is more likely to happen with the breeze.
She said, “If we had a mix of conditions that would be cool, but I’m expecting it to be on the lighter side.”
With two top 10 finishes in the Garda and Trentino Olympic Week and Delta Lloyd Regatta, as well as a 13th place at the
ISAF Sailing World Cup Weymouth and Portland, Snellgrove will be looking for a good result in Qingdao.
Snellgrove said, “I’m looking to try and put together a solid regatta and work on a few things I need to adjust, so that is my aim for the week.”
Laser Radial racing in Qingdao will commence at 12:10 on Wednesday 16 September.

ISAF Sailing World Cup
The ISAF Sailing World Cup is a world-class annual series for Olympic sailing. It is open to the sailing events chosen for the 2016 Olympic Sailing Competition. Its centre piece is the ISAF Sailing World Cup Final in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ates.
The 2015 ISAF Sailing World Cup will consist of five regattas for all ten Olympic events and where possible, Formula Kite Racing. Qualification places for the ISAF Sailing World Cup final are up for grabs at each event. The final will bring together the top 20 boats in each Olympic event and an Open Kiteboarding event where the World Cup Champions will be crowned
